If you're searching for a delightful family outing this summer, Patterson Farm in Mount Ulla, N.C., offers an array of engaging activities sure to excite all ages. Open from June 10 to August 3, 2024, Monday through Saturday, from 9 a.m. to 2 p.m., the farm provides a perfect mix of entertainment, education, and relaxation.

What to Expect

Pick Your Own Strawberries
Until June 15, you can pick your own strawberries, a fun and tasty activity for the whole family. Be sure to come early as this is available while supplies last.

 

Animal Encounters
In the barnyard, get up close and personal with a variety of farm animals, including cows, chickens, goats, pigs, ducks, and peacocks. Each visitor receives one cup of animal feed to interact with the animals, enhancing the farm experience.

Pawpaw Carl’s Playground & Barnyard
Explore Pawpaw Carl’s Playground, featuring Big Red’s Slide, the Spider Web, a Farm to Table Play Area, and a Tractor Tire Mountain. The playground also has a Sand Pit Area, Music and Mud Pie Area, and a picnic space for a relaxing lunch. Children and adults alike will enjoy these engaging play areas.

Additional Information

  • Ticket Prices: $10 per person online (plus processing fees), $12 at the gate. Children under 2 enter for free.
  • Senior Discount: Seniors over 55 receive a 10% discount on admission or market purchases on Tuesdays.
  • Food and Ice Cream: Don’t miss the hand-dipped ice creams available at the farm, perfect for a summer treat.
